# heavy_left

![heavy_left](https://github.com/takashicompany/heavy_left/blob/master/images/qmk.jpg)
![heavy_left](https://i.imgur.com/cWHrklQh.jpeg)

This is a 95-key split type Japanese keyboard.  
It has a numeric keypad on the left hand side, which can be used not only for entering numbers but also as a dedicated macro pad.
